2015 ARS to CAD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2015

During 2015, the ARS to CAD ex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 31, valuing the pair at 0.1473.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 17, dropping to 0.1045.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0428 CAD.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.1406 to the December average rate of 0.1234, the exchange rate registered a net change of -12.24%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2015 high of 0.1473 was down 10.34% compared to the 2014 peak of 0.1643,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
